Abstract

The integration and promotion of intelligent technology in the education industry has led to the introduction of more and more intelligent assistive teaching tools and platforms into the classroom, and the traditional classroom mode and teaching form are undergoing significant changes. This paper utilizes a university teaching and quality evaluation system to design the teaching evaluation module. Improving the particle swarm optimization algorithm and combining it with the K-Means algorithm has resulted in the construction of a teaching evaluation model based on the PSKA algorithm. The model is incorporated into the English teaching and quality evaluation system in colleges and universities. The PSKA algorithm is used to cluster students’ learning situations and divide four categories of students with different learning levels. Targeted guidance for each category of students’ learning problems can effectively improve the quality of teaching. The questionnaire survey revealed that 61.07% of English teachers understood the model, with 47.25% saying they actively use it and recommend it to other teachers. It is evident that the teaching evaluation model based on the PSKA algorithm is recognized by most English teachers.
